How far is Watertown, CT from Manchester, CT?
The driving distance from Watertown, CT to Manchester, CT is about 46.9 miles (75.5 km), with a travel time of about 00h 52m by car.
- The straight-line flight distance is about 32.9 miles (53 km).
- For a round trip, plan for roughly 01h 44m of driving time before adding stops, traffic, or weather delays.
